> > Hi all,
>
> > I am experiencing a problem in ldap user authentication over SASL
> > +GSSAPI with a Microsoft AD 2003. After doing the "kinit", I have get
> > the first user ticket. But when I try to do a SASL bind with mechanism
> > GSSAPI, and try to give the same user principal that I gave to kinit
> > in the first SASL step that asks "Please enter your authorization
> > name" (code 0x4001), I get the service ticket (as shown by the klist
> > command), but my ldap sasl bind fails with the message
>
> > "LdapErr: DSID-0C09043E, comment: AcceptSecurityContext error, data
> > 7a, vece"
>
> > with LDAP return code 49 means Invalid Credentials. I am using a
> > custom client here. The code is pasted after the environment details.
> > Please go through the code. By the way, I am getting the user and
> > service tickets from the AD server, its just the bind which is failing
> > in the SASL. In normal (simple bind), it is succeeding.
>
> > Here is the environment details
>
> > Server
> > =======
> > Microsoft Server 2003
>
> > Client
> > ======
> > RedHat ES 3
> > MozillaLDAP 6.0.4
> > Cyrus-sasl 2.1.22
>
